Understanding Your Conservatory Roof

Before diving into maintenance, it's important to familiarize oneself with the kinds of conservatory roofing systems available. The most typical types include:

Roof TypeDescription
Glass RoofMade of double or triple-glazed panels that permit natural light but need regular cleansing.
Polycarbonate RoofLight-weight and affordable, however can become cloudy and need replacement over time.
Solid RoofConsists of tiles or slate materials providing much better insulation and resilience.

Each kind of roof has its own set of maintenance requirements.

Common Issues in Conservatory Roofs

Before describing the maintenance actions, it's crucial to comprehend the problems that can occur with conservatory roofs. Regular evaluations can help catch these issues early:

IssueSignsSuggested Action
LeaksWater spots on ceilings or walls, puddles on the flooringInspect seals and joints; repair as needed
CondensationWetness on the within the glass or panels, mold developmentEnhance ventilation; consider dehumidifiers
Dirty PanelsDust and gunk reducing light transmissionRegular cleansing with proper solutions
Damaged SealsCracks or noticeable wear around edgesChange seals to prevent air and water leaks
Structural DamageVisible fractures or sagging in the roof structureSeek advice from a professional for repairs

Vital Maintenance Tips

Keeping a conservatory roof includes some straightforward practices that can save homeowners a great deal of money in possible repairs. Below are some vital tips for keeping your conservatory roof in top shape:

1. Routine Cleaning

Cleaning the conservatory roof ought to become part of an annual maintenance strategy. Depending upon the type of roof, cleaning can vary:

  • Glass Roof: Use a non-abrasive glass cleaner and a soft fabric or squeegee. Prevent utilizing severe chemicals that might cause damage.
  • Polycarbonate Roof: Use a soft brush or sponge with mild cleaning agent. Rinse completely as residues can dull the panels.
  • Solid Roof: Regularly inspect the tiles and tidy debris. Utilize a pressure washer on lower settings if needed.

2. Examine Seals and Joints

Regularly check the seals around the edges of the roof where glass or panels meet. If they appear split or used, re-sealing might be necessary. This will help prevent leaks and drafts.

3. Look For Structural Integrity

At least as soon as a year, take a look at the whole structure for any signs of wear and tear, sagging, or cracks. If you discover any considerable issues, speak with a professional for evaluation and repair.

4. Upkeep of Guttering

Gutters play an important function in diverting rainwater away from the roof and the conservatory itself. Clear leaves and particles routinely and look for obstructions, specifically after storms.

Gutter Maintenance Checklist

TaskFrequency
Clear debrisMonthly
Examine for leaksBi-annually
Clean downspoutsEach year

5. Ventilation Management

Appropriate ventilation is crucial to lowering condensation and preserving a comfy environment. Open doors and windows when possible, and think about setting up roof vents for enhanced air flow.

6. Seasonal Preparations

Prepare your conservatory roof for seasonal modifications. Before winter, check for loose tiles or panels, and in fall, eliminate leaves and branches that may collect.

Frequently Asked Question About Conservatory Roof Maintenance

Q1: How frequently should I clean my conservatory roof?

A: It is suggested to clean your conservatory roof a minimum of two times a year. However, more regular cleansing might be needed depending upon environmental aspects like neighboring trees or contamination.

Q2: What can I do about condensation in my conservatory?

A: To combat condensation, improve ventilation, use a dehumidifier, and guarantee that there are no blockages blocking airflow.

Q3: Can I perform repairs myself?

A: Minor repairs like re-sealing or cleaning can be done by homeowners. Nevertheless, for structural repairs or major issues, working with a professional is encouraged.

Q4: How do I understand if my conservatory roof needs replacing?

A: Signs that might indicate a need for replacement include extensive leaks, significant structural damage, or panels that are completely cloudy.

Q5: Are there particular cleansing products I should avoid?

A: Yes, prevent utilizing abrasive cleaners, bleach, or any product that can scratch the surface area of glass or polycarbonate products.
